Subdivision 1.Procedure.

(a)The articles of a cooperative shall be amended as follows:
(1)the board, by majority vote, shall pass a resolution stating the text of the proposed amendment. The text of the proposed amendment and an attached mail or alternative ballot, if the board has provided for a mail or alternative ballot in the resolution, shall be mailed or otherwise distributed with a regular or special meeting notice to each member. The notice shall designate the time and place of the meeting for the proposed amendment to be considered and voted on; and
(2)if a quorum of the members is registered as being present or represented by alternative vote at the meeting, the proposed amendment is adopted:
(i)if approved by a majority of the votes cast; or
